Georgian Authorities not Ready to Hold Victorious Elections – Georgian Politic

Georgia Materials 28 December 2007 14:12 (UTC +04:00)

Georgia, Tbilisi / Trend corr. N.Kirtskhalia / Mamuka Giorgadze, the leader of the opposition Popular Party of Georgia, considers that the Georgian leadership attempt to make contradictions within the country as their candidate for the president post Michael Saakashvili, is noncompetative.

"The current government cannot guarantee that the former President Saakashvili can win the upcoming presidential election scheduled on 5 January 2008," Giorgadze said in the interview to the Trend agency. The current government is well informed that the population do not support Saakashvili's candidature. The presidential elections in Georgia are scheduled on 5 January 2008.
